The issue wasn't the mounts, but a member organizing a group buy and disappearing with the money. The mounts should be just fine. :)

I have not personally used the innovative mounts, but some of the threads on here suggest that they are very similar to the PRI (place racing incorporated). The most trouble I had with the swap in the 12k miles I drove it, was with the axles. I trashed a couple trying to get the right combination, this (http://www.3geez.com/forum/showthread.php?t=49155) thread will tell you everything about the basics. I can't guarantee that the innovative mounts will work with the same shift rod, or that the axle setup will fit either. Everything else should match up the same. No the biggest problem was finding the proper combination to actually work with the swap. Below is what I ended up using. After figuring out this combination, it was all plug and play. As far as swapping anything besides the B-series, I don't know what to tell you about anything in regards to that.



Passenger Axle: 87-89 Acura Integra Passenger Side Axle (A little long, but it works)
Drivers Axle: The center shaft of the axle comes from the passenger side of the 86-89 accord. The ends (parts that connect to the hub, and to the transmission) are from an 88-91 Integra. This axle was put together for me by a professional axle shop, almost any axle repair place should be able to do it for you.
